In this engaging discussion, Guy Costantini, CEO and co-founder of an innovative game studio, shares his insights on effective marketing for indie games. He emphasizes the crucial role of marketing alongside development, recommending that studios allocate 20-30% of their budget to this area. Guy delves into community-driven marketing strategies, the balance between funding development and promotion, and the nuances of different game categories like indie and AAA. He also highlights opportunities across various platforms and the importance of understanding your audience.

The Importance of Early Marketing in Game Development

Effective marketing should begin early in the game development process, rather than when the game is already completed. Many game developers underestimate the significance of marketing and only consider it at the end, which often leads to poor visibility and sales. It is recommended that developers allocate a marketing budget equal to or greater than the development budget to ensure their game reaches its target audience. Marketing is not a secondary consideration; it is an essential component that can significantly impact a game's success in a crowded market.
